Yes i agree with you,if you are going to buy from one of these spec building company's wait to the houses are finished

and you can take immediate possesion, there is no real protection for people who make progressive payments in Thailand

I have been told of developers who sell the same property to more than one person, take their money and disappear

Sounds better than most developers, do you have monthly estate fee's and if you do how much are they

and do the houses have their own water/electricity meters and pay the service providers direct or to the developers

Also are all the houses connected to all esential services when complete, Phone, cable etc, not wired but not connected

The Common area management fee is 2800thb /mo atm, shall be paid upfront once per year.

All meters are registered to the House Owner name, we are not involved in the prices for electricity and water. Only we can help you to pay them when you don't have time to do it yourself.

On completion we connect cable/tv and internet, we can also connect to a phone live if needed.
